Case Study: 800 users Automating key business process and workflows provides consistent delivery and contract compliance for a Fortune 500 managed care organization. 	A Fortune 500 company focusing on Medicaid and Medicare that offers a variety of health plans for families, children, the aged, blind, and disabled, as well as prescription drug plans. The company served more than 2.5 million members nationwide as of December 31, 2008. 	The priority for this company was to automate processes, eliminate redundant data entry, improve productivity and accuracy, while reducing support costs and increasing efficiencies. The Company wished to “retire” multiple, dispersed legacy systems in place and focus on:
Case Study: 800 users Key Drivers:		• Centralizing information		• Improving member and provider satisfaction		• Enhancing the interactivity of medical management		• Improving the accuracy of information and authorizations		• Supporting new programs and markets, as the Company grows
